Hi guys, does anyone know how to stop Mail from retrieving all of my emails, basically when I set it up it always starts to retrieve all of my emails from my Gmail account, I probably wouldn't mind but I have about 30,000 emails and that takes up a lot of space
 
Go into Mail Preferences>Accounts>Advanced and try unticking "Include when automatically checking for new messages".

Edit: I realised what the problem was, it's an issue with IMAP and Gmail, well it might not be an issue but I just don't like using IMAP, I was able to setup my Gmail account through Mac Mail using POP instead and all is good now, it only retrieves new messages now which is the way I wanted it
